Key Factors Driving the Market
Several factors are influencing the housing market in New Mexico this spring. Interest rates remain relatively low, encouraging more people to consider purchasing a home. Additionally, there is a noticeable increase in demand for homes in suburban and rural areas as remote work becomes more prevalent. This shift is leading to a competitive market, particularly for properties that offer extra space and outdoor amenities.
For first-time buyers, it's essential to understand that the supply of homes is still catching up with demand. This can mean faster decision-making and potentially higher prices. However, staying informed and prepared can help navigate these challenges.
Preparing for Your Home Buying Journey
Before diving into the home buying process, it's important to get your finances in order. This includes checking your credit score, saving for a down payment, and understanding the types of loans available to you. First-time buyers might benefit from programs that offer lower down payments or assistance with closing costs.

Tips for First-Time Buyers
Here are some tips to help you get started:
- Get pre-approved for a mortgage: This shows sellers that you're a serious buyer and gives you a clear idea of your budget.
- Work with a local real estate agent: They can provide valuable insights into the New Mexico market and help you find homes that meet your criteria.
- Be flexible with your wish list: While it's important to know what you want, being willing to compromise can open up more opportunities.

The Importance of a Home Inspection
Once you've found a potential home, a thorough inspection is crucial. This will help identify any underlying issues that could affect the property's value or your future enjoyment of the home. It's an essential step that shouldn't be overlooked, even in a competitive market.
Making Your Offer Stand Out
In a competitive market, making a strong offer is key. Consider including a personal letter to the seller, expressing your appreciation for the home and why it’s the perfect fit for you. This personal touch can sometimes make a big difference.
